We have a number of big corporate stories. Tomorrow gms Ceo Mary Barra is facing a Congressional Panel to try to get to the bottom of the automakers recall crisis. Shell be asked why it took so long for the company to identify and address ignition switch problems. Auto parts maker delphi told investigators gm approved ignition switches for cars that have now been linked to 12 deaths, even though the parts did not appear to meet the companys specifications.
